Former middleweight champion Kelly Pavlik has confirmed that there was a physical confrontation between him and his brother, Michael Pavlik Jr., last Friday night at their parents' home, but he denies consuming any alcohol at the time of the incident. According to Youngstown police reports, both men were allegedly drinking at the time of the incident, and after a verbal argument Kelly Pavlik punched a door to the home and pulled his brother out of the broken window.
Kelly Pavlik, who via telephone spoke to a Youngstown television station on Tuesday, admits that he did arrive at his parents' home and ended up in a fight with his brother but said he was not drinking and has no idea why his brother told police that he consumed alcohol at the time of their incident. Michael Pavlik declined to press charges.
Kelly was released from alcohol abuse treatment in January. He returns to the ring on August 6th against Darryl Cunningham in Showtime televised fight.
